OK... I've been a Vonage customer now for about 3 years and have been annoyed by 2 things. 

First, it's not clear why I can't get a local area code for the area I'm in. I have to settle for an out of area code because Vonage doesn't have any area codes for the central valley here in California. This isn't some small patch in the mountains... I'm talking about many counties in the middle of California. 

Second is Annonymous Call Rejection and it's related features. This is a mainstay of almost every other calling service and for the life of me I don't know why Vonage doesn't have it.

It seems to me that if Vonage wants to keep their customer base and become a profitable company the would add this feature as soon as posssible. As soon as I move to the bay area I'm going to be switching my VoIP service to one that offers this functionality.
